The model rates Lazio's attack at 1.21x the league average against Parma's defence at 1.09x — combine the two and it projects 1.59 expected goals for the hosts. Flip it around — Parma's attack (0.66x) against Lazio's defence (1.12x) — and the away total comes out at 0.82.

These ratings are built from 71/33 games of current-season data — a full enough sample to trust.
